Can You Really Get a Loan Without Submitting Documents?
Yes, but here’s what that actually means. It doesn’t mean no verification. It means no physical paperwork. You don’t have to scan and upload payslips or carry printed ID proofs. Instead, everything happens online.
You’ll need your PAN and Aadhaar, and your mobile number should be linked to Aadhaar for OTP verification. The lender may also check your income using secure access to your salary account or request permission to review your account statements digitally.
So yes, you can apply for an instant Personal Loan without documents, but the process still includes some checks – just done digitally instead of manually.
Who Can Apply for a Paperless Personal Loan?
These loans are usually offered to salaried professionals between 21 and 60 years old. Some lenders also extend them to self-employed individuals, depending on their income history and digital transaction records. You’re likely to qualify if:
- You earn a stable monthly income.
- Your Aadhaar and PAN are up-to-date and linked to your mobile number.
- Your CIBIL score is reasonably strong (usually 700 or above, though some lenders go lower).
Is This Method of Borrowing Actually Safe?
As long as you’re dealing with a registered lender or a reliable platform, the process is secure. What matters is where you’re applying from. Avoid unknown apps, especially those that ask for full access to your phone, contacts, or gallery. That’s unnecessary and should be a red flag.

Before applying, always check if the lender is listed under RBI-registered financial institutions. That’s a good way to filter out the unreliable ones.
What Kind of Loan Amounts and Tenures Are Typically Offered?
Loan amounts offered can go up to Rs. 5 lakh or more, depending on your income and credit profile. For new borrowers or first-time applicants, the approved amount may be lower at first. If you repay on time, some lenders allow you to unlock higher limits later.
Repayment tenures range from 3 months to 3 years. You can usually pick the repayment period that suits you, though shorter tenures often come with higher EMIs.
Before you decide, think about how much you actually need. Just because you’re eligible for Rs. 2 lakh doesn’t mean you should borrow that much. Choose an amount you can repay comfortably without cutting into essential expenses.
Do These Loans Come With Higher Interest Rates?
In some cases, yes. Since these loans are unsecured and processed quickly, lenders often charge a slightly higher interest to cover their risk. But not all of them do. Your rate depends on your credit score, income level, repayment history, and sometimes even the company you work for.
If you’ve got a strong CIBIL score and a stable income, you might get a competitive offer. Some lenders also offer flexible rates that adjust based on your profile. That means the more consistent your financial behaviour, the better your rate.
Before saying yes, compare interest rates from at least two platforms. And don’t forget to factor in processing fees or late payment penalties. They all add up in the end.

Can I Repay the Loan Early? Are There Prepayment Charges?
Most lenders allow early repayment, but some may have a lock-in period of around three to six months. Others charge a small fee if you repay before the end of your tenure.
It’s a good idea to ask about this before accepting the loan offer. If your goal is to save on interest, paying off the loan early can help. Just make sure you’re aware of any charges involved.
Also, check if part-payments are allowed. Being able to pay in chunks gives you more control and can reduce your total interest.
